Frequently, drugs bind non-particularly to albumin while in the plasma. In addition, a person drug, digoxin, tends to bind non-specially to skeletal muscle mass, when, the truth is, its desired steps occur in the center. When drugs bind non-precisely to proteins, their movement is restricted. That is since the significant proteins to which They may be certain won't be in a position to commonly distribute to other areas of the body. The protein functions for a “reservoir” of types. Providing a drug is certain non-specifically to the protein, it are unable to have a therapeutic motion, nor can or not it's eradicated (metabolized hepatically from the liver or excreted through the kidneys). Non-specific binding to drugs may also Perform a task in drug-drug interactions; if two or maybe more drugs are competing for a similar binding web page, a person drug will displace the other, thus, resulting in opportunity toxicity attributable to the drug that was displaced.

The notion of “apparent quantity of distribution” is an idea that seeks to forecast how thoroughly a drug is distributed through the system. The apparent volume of distribution, Vd, is mathematically calculated by dividing the dose that is administered (mg) with the plasma focus (mg/L).
